Bob Diamond bags a diamond tipped bonus from Barclays.

The banking business is now a computerised casino for making money out of bytes. Touch the button and zeros become prime numbers with alacrity. Bob Diamond is the chief of Barclays Bank. He gets a salary of £250,000 for his day job. For his croupier activities he gets a whopping £6,500,000!

Now I'm firmly behind David Cameron's notion that the entrepreneurial community is going to get Britain out of the mire. But what did Bob Diamond do entrepreneurially last year to get his salary paid 26 times over in ONE YEAR?
